Campari Group, the maker of Aperol, is making its largest-ever investment in an aperitivo launch with the introduction of Sarti in the U.S. market. This new hot-pink aperitif, infused with blood orange, passion fruit, and mango, is designed to be sweeter and more fruit-forward than its predecessors, aiming to attract a new generation of aperitivo drinkers. The company believes Sarti's "bold, expressive" nature and vibrant color will appeal to consumers seeking playful and audacious experiences, expanding on the success of the Aperol Spritz phenomenon.

The launch campaign for Sarti, titled "Too Pink to Care," began on September 8, 2026, in New York and will continue in San Diego. Marketing activities include the installation of "oversized mystery pink luggage trunks" in Manhattan, Brooklyn, and San Diego, and a Sarti-branded pink boat sailing along New York's Hudson and East Rivers on September 12. Campari America's Head of Marketing, Allison Varone, stated that Sarti strengthens their spritz portfolio and underscores their commitment to the category, which they view as an important area of growth.

Sarti joins Aperol, Campari, and the non-alcoholic Crodino in Campari Group's U.S. aperitivo portfolio. The company sees a growing appetite for such brands, with the aperitivo category representing $11 billion annually and expecting 6% growth through 2028. While Aperol has seen significant success, accounting for nearly a third of Campari Group's $3 billion in annual revenue in the first half of 2026, Sarti represents an effort to diversify and innovate within the spritz market, which Campari has effectively cultivated as a recognizable and exportable Italian ritual.
